Gamma-ray tracking Team leader: Araceli Lopez-Martens http: //www-csnsm. in 2 p 3. fr/groupes/strucnuc/trackteam. html Existing algorithms: • Clusterization + forward tracking • Back tracking • Clusterization + probabilistic method • 1 st hit identification with fuzzy Logic + fuzzy cluster AGATA Week, GSI, 21 -25 February 2005 Johan Nyberg
